Telephone mode, function - GF82.85-P-2007RM

MODEL 230.4 as of 1.6.04 with CODE (388) "Portable CTEL" UPCI telephone system with CODE (527) COMAND APS (with navigation) 

The telephone system can be operated as follows:

The audio source is automatically muted during a telephone call. The following will describe the telephone operation in further detail. The telephone radio signals are transmitted and received by the telephone antenna (A2/22). The display of the COMAND operating, display and control unit (A40/3) shows the destination field strengths in 5 grades when the telephone is in its ready status.

All control signals and useful signals (e.g. sound signals with hands-free system activated) are transmitted via the Media Oriented System Transport (MOST). The portable CTEL (A34/6) requires an interface to the MOST to do this, which is implemented via the Universal Portable CTEL Interface (UPCI [UHI]) control unit (N123/1). Data safety, SMS buffer 

When the power supply fails, the characters stored in the buffer are saved. However, it is possible for up to 4 characters to be lost. When switched off in a controlled manner, no characters are lost. Creating and processing an SMS is possible only when SMS messages are present in the buffer. Characters are entered with the predictive text input (speller) or via the keypad on the COMAND operating, display and control unit (A40/3) (analogous to the portable CTEL).

These functions are also used for sending SMS messages; a recipient can be entered or selected from the telephone book.

Switching back on controlled and uncontrolled 

After switching back on, the basic telephone display appears. By selecting menu point "SMS" the main SMS menu can be displayed. The editing process can be continued with the predictive text input (speller) after selecting "process SMS" in the SMS main menu.
